Protection of Children from Sexual Offences Act, 2012 As amended by The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(Amdt.) Act, 2019

This edition of The Protection of Children from Sexual Offences Act, 2012 (Act 32 of 2012, dated 19-6-2012), as amended by The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(Amendment) Act, 2019 (Act 25 of 2019, dated 5-8-2019, enforced from 16-8-2019 vide S.O. 2759(E), dated 16-8-2019), The Jammu and Kashmir Reorganisation Act, 2019 (Act 34 of 2019, dated 9-8-2019, enforced from 31-10-2019 vide S.O. 2889(E), dated 9-8-2019), and The Criminal Law (Amendment) Act, 2018 (Act 22 of 2018, dated 11-8-2018, enforced from 21-4-2018), is presented along with The Protection of Children from Sexual Offences Rules, 2020 (enforced from 9-3-2020 vide G.S.R. 165(E), dated 9-3-2020). This Act provides a comprehensive legal framework for the protection of children from sexual offences, safeguarding their rights through child-friendly procedures at every stage of the judicial process.


The book presents the bare text of the law—precisely as enacted—without commentary or interpretation, making it ideal for statutory referencing, judicial application, academic study, and rights-based advocacy. It ensures direct access to the statutory provisions and rules for effective prevention, reporting, investigation, and prosecution of sexual offences against children.


The content spans the full scope of the Act and Rules, including:

• Definitions of sexual assault, penetrative sexual assault, aggravated sexual assault, and sexual harassment of children

• Special provisions for the protection of children in vulnerable situations

• Mandatory reporting obligations and procedures for recording complaints

• Guidelines for child-friendly investigation and trial processes

• Establishment and functioning of Special Courts for speedy trial

• Provisions for safeguarding the identity and privacy of child victims

• Enhanced punishments for aggravated offences, including life imprisonment and death penalty in specific cases

• Duties of police, Special Juvenile Police Units, and Child Welfare Committees

• Provisions under the 2020 Rules for victim support services, compensation, and rehabilitation

• Safeguards against misuse while ensuring child protection objectives are met
